Adani Green Energy Limited (AGEL) has announced the commissioning of two significant renewable energy projects in Gujarat, reinforcing its commitment to India’s clean energy mission.
Adani Renewable Energy Forty Eight Limited, a step-down subsidiary of AGEL, has successfully commissioned a 62.4 MW wind power component as part of its wind-solar hybrid project at Khavda, Gujarat. Additionally, Adani Green Energy Twenty Four A Limited, another step-down subsidiary, has completed a 112.5 MW solar power project in the same region.
With the commissioning of these projects, AGEL’s total operational renewable energy capacity has reached 11,608.9 MW. The projects were cleared for operation at 7:37 p.m. on December 28, 2024, with power generation commencing from December 29, 2024.
